Mistery Sensor where is it?

I get A/C and REC lights blinking after ignition turn on. Check the code, Exterior Temp Sensor Shorted to 12V or Open", could it be that it really doesn't exist. The picture in the Haynes manual shows the general location of the sensor (right side vent on the firewall) but it's not there.

A/C works 1/2 of the time, it seems to quite when it is too hot, but when it works is very confortable. I had it charged last year and they didn't detect any leak, or bad evaporater.

I also bypassed the infamous temp switch which used to equip the earlier A/C units, but to no avail.

Basically I never know when I'm going to have A/C when I get in the car, it is that unpredictable.

1994 850 Turbo Wagon, 80K miles. Otherwise flawless.
